Libero! is a football supporters association associated with the libertarian and anti-environmental LM network. It was established by Carlton Brick [1] in 1996 while LM network associate Duleep Allirajah wrote for its journal, Offence [2]. It is now defunct.
It was reinterpreted as Liberofootball, an online football magazine, in October 2008. [3]
INt has no known connection with Libero UK or Libero Football Academy.
